Job overview
This role is responsible for managing end to end Source to Settle activities for the assigned portfolio which primarily consists of indirect spend, such as consulting services, recruitment services, legal, finance and tax advisory services, creative agencies, media and production etc. This role also implies supporting Associate Director, SRM, Demand and Contract management with the activities related to:Annual Group-wide supplier performance management Demand consolidation and analysis
Your impact on our goals
Sourcing and procurement / Source to Settle:Contributes into the overall Ooredoo strategic sourcing mission of the department. Ensures execution of savings targets and related action plans for assigned categories. Liaises with relevant functions to receive sourcing requests and ensures they are implemented swiftly and accurately. Develops sourcing strategy, secures alignment with business units and secures necessary approvals. Manages all up-stream activities including RFx process, vendor negotiation and contract finalization in conjunction with the superior. Ensures timely and accurate completion of all downstream activities i.e. validation of Purchase Requisitions and issuance of preparation of Purchase Orders. Ensures all activities follow the prescribed governance and maintains the highest standards of transparency and fairness. Manages the reporting requirement for the function and tracks compliance. Constantly seeks to update own knowledge and that of others within the department in relation to industry standards for Strategic Sourcing of high value products or services. Establishes and manages category strategies within the assigned domains Supports the day-to-day operations in line with the required standards of Ooredoo to deliver the highest level of service to internal customers whilst at the same time building supplier relationships to ensure that Ooredoo’s suppliers become long term business partners.
Supplier performance management Preparation of the data for the annual supplier performance evaluation and action planning Reporting and cadence management, action tracking on the supplier improvement actions Continuous review of the framework of SPM in the Group and identification of areas for improvement as well as action planning
Demand management Consolidation of the demand inputs from Ooredoo entities Review of the submissions and analysis for potential areas of efficiency and consolidation at Group level
Other Supports overall team with the reporting requirements (monthly, quarterly reports on the key procurement and sourcing KPIs)
